The Jupiter Skate Park is now open for use by all participants with additional restrictions in accordance with the Palm Beach County Emergency Order 2020-011. All CDC recommended social distancing guidelines must be adhered to throughout the park. The Skate Park will continue operating by reservation only for a maximum of 10 participants in each 90-minute session. Additionally, the roller hockey rinks will open for a maximum of 10 participants at a time. These updated restrictions, hours, and sessions will be in place until further notice. Updated Skate Park Hours - New 90 Minute Session Times:
Monday-Friday 1:00pm-9:00pm
4 Sessions starting at 1:00pm, 3:00pm, 5:00pm and 7:00pm (ends at 8:30pm)
Saturday 9:00am-9:00pm
6 Sessions starting at 9:00am, 11:00am, 1:00pm, 3:00pm, 5:00pm, and 7:00pm (ends at 8:30pm)
Sunday 12:00pm-6:00pm
3 Sessions starting at 12:00pm, 2:00pm, and 4:00pm (ends at 5:30pm)
User Limits and Rules:
- All Jupiter Skate Park rules and regulations are in effect.
- Session fee is $2.00 for participants without a valid skate park membership.
- There is a maximum of 10 participants per session by reservation only.
- Participants must call to reserve a spot in a session. Skate Park staff will begin taking reservations for the day 1 hour before the first session of the day. Please call (561) 630-5684 to make a reservation and arrive no more than 5 minutes prior to your reserved session time.
- Participants may reserve up to 1 session per day.
- Social distancing guidelines must be followed.
- All participants must have their own equipment.
- Maximum of 10 parent/guardian(s) of participants will be allowed in the observation area and all social distancing guidelines must be followed.
- Roller hockey rinks will be open for use by a maximum of 10 participants at a time.
- Participants will not be allowed to congregate outside the Skate Park.
- The water fountain will be closed.
